Get in touch and I'll send s pic Anonymoushttps://www.blogger.com/profile/07708531301582431088noreply@blogger.comtag:blogger.com,1999:blog-2503961192903372491.post-40004940901008933962020-07-10T12:59:31.883+01:002020-07-10T12:59:31.883+01:00Hello, I have had several inquires about Doulton b...Hello, I have had several inquires about Doulton bricks & pipes being found in Argentina. Our two countries were closer trade wise in the late 1800's & early 1900's than they are today, so I am not surprised by you finding Doulton pipes in Argentina. Doulton's were a well known brand & were reputed to be the best in producing good quality products on a large scale. Doulton's may have even had an office in Buenos Aires to take orders, if not I am sure there will have been a representative in the capital. Hope this has helped in some way. Cómo no se Anonymoushttps://www.blogger.com/profile/03828159559980598401noreply@blogger.comtag:blogger.com,1999:blog-2503961192903372491.post-10119969034236738202019-04-03T17:07:47.085+01:002019-04-03T17:07:47.085+01:00Hi I'm Spanish and I have a brick of DOULTON &...Hi I'm Spanish and I have a brick of DOULTON & C of the blues I think it's 1812<br /><br />Hello Unknown, I don't think your brick could have been made in 1812. First John Doulton did not start his pottery business until 1815. Second, bricks were not made with company names until 1855 & third, the first record that I have for Doulton & Co. producing bricks is 1872. So I think your brick will have been made between 1872 & 1920. Thanks for your interest in Doulton & Co.<br /><br />Hola, Desconocido, no creo que su ladrillo pudiera haberse hecho en 1812.
